Three more airports reach Net Zero for emissions under their control in the timespan of COP30

Highlighting the global airport community’s steadfast commitment to fighting climate change, Salvador Bahia Airport in Brazil and Adelaide and Parafield airports in Australia have reached Level 5 of Airport Carbon Accreditation during COP30.
